removing paint from calipers and drums
i bought my car used and the previous owner painted the calipers, drums, letters on the engine cover, oil cap, and prop rod red. although i m runnin bare steelies i do not want my brakes red since i m gonna go for the black out look when eventually have the money to go full bore and i have off skool this week so i figure it would be a premo time remove the paint. the stuff under the hood bothers me, but the brakes bother me worse. what is the best way to remove it? brake cleaner? black paint? and i dont mind having the silvery grey bare metal look.

On the drums I removed them and used aircraft stripper. Took em right down to virgin metal. On the front I wire wheeled them then wiped em down with brake cleaner and painted them.
